银杏花粉及其发酵饮料对小鼠的急性毒性评价
Acute Toxic Effects of Ginkgo Pollen and Its Fermentation Beverage on Mice
摘要
Abstract
[Objective] To evaluate the edible safety of ginkgo pollen and its fermentation beverage.[Method] Healthy mice were chosen for acute toxicity test.High-dose pilot study and maximum dose experiment were carried out,as well as determination of the thymus and spleen coefficients of the mice in this dose.[Result] The mice in the high-dose pilot study were all alive,no abnormal reaction,and the LD50 could not be measured.The maximum dose experiment showed that except the accidental death of one mouse,no other death or poisoning symptoms occur,and the activities and organs were all normal.The maximum dose of ginkgo pollen and its fermentation beverage were 21.1 g/kg and 80.0 mL/kg,respectively.These dose were much higher than those could be ingested,and the thymus and spleen coefficients of the mice in this dose were increased.[Conclusion] There are no acute toxic effects of ginkgo pollen and its fermentation beverage on mice,and prompting that they might have some immune enhancement effects on male mice.关键词
